A-D-Mannose, 1-phosphate

This enzyme [EC 2.7.7.13], also known as GTP-mannose-1-phosphate guanylyltransferase, catalyzes the reaction of GTP with a-D-mannose 1-phosphate to produce GDP-mannose and pyrophosphate (or, diphosphate). The bacterial enzyme can also use ITP and dGTP as the phospho-ryl donors. [Pg.441]

In section 10.1, we saw that the first hexose to be formed in the fixation of CO2 was D-fructose-l,6-bisphosphate. This sugar phosphate is converted to D-fruc-tose-6-phosphate by a specific phosphatase (reaction 10.3). The keto group can be epimerized by two different enzymes, D-fructose-6-phosphate/D-glucose epimer-ase or D-fructose-6-phosphate/D-mannose epimerase, to form D-glucose-6-phosphate and D-mannose-6-phosphate, respectively (see Fig. 10.5). Both of these sugar phosphates can be converted into their 1-phosphates by reaction with specific mutase enzymes. a-D-Glucose-1-phosphate and a-D-mannose-1-phosphate can then react with UTP and GTP to form UDP-Glc and GDP-Man (see Fig. 10.5). [Pg.299]

Immunological studies have confirmed that Bacillus pumilus Sh-17 polysaccharide cross-reacts with meningococcal group A polysaccharide. The cross-reaction is ascribed to the presence of residues of 2-acetamido-2-deoxy-D-mannose 1-phosphate in both polysaccharides. As 2-amino-2-deoxy-D-mannose is tumorstatic and 2-acetamido-2-deoxy-D-mannose 6-phosphate is an obligatory intermediate in the biosynthetic pathway to sialic acid, displacement of the essential OH-6 with a fluorine atom should be interesting from the biological viewpoint. 2-Acetamido-1,3,4-tri-0-acetyl-2,6-dideoxy-6-fluoro-D-mannopyranose (see Table 111 in Section 11,3) and its O- and A,0-deacetyl derivatives were prepared the first compound showed weak anticancer activity. [Pg.210]

It is D-fructofuranose, not D-fructopyranose, that is utilized, at least by bakers yeast.303,304 As with D-glucose, the initial step in the intracellular utilization of either D-fructofuranose305 or D-mannose is phosphorylation by the constitutive hexokinase306 (see Ref. 307 for a review). The D-fructose 6-phosphate formed is an intermediate of both the glycolytic pathway and the pentose cycle. D-Mannose phosphate isomerase (EC 5.3.1.8) effects the conversion of D-mannose 6-phosphate into D-fructose 6-phosphate,308,309 or D-mannose 6-phosphate is epimerized to D-glucose 6-phosphate.308... [Pg.173]

Aldoses react with ATP in a phosphotransferase-catalyzed reaction (C 1.1) either to sugar-l-phosphates, e.g., D-galactose-l-phosphate and L-arabinose-1-phosphate, or to sugar-co-phosphates, e.g., D-glucose-6-phosphate (Fig. 27), D-mannose-6-phosphate, D-galactose-6-phosphate, and D-ribose-5-phosphate. Aldose-l-phosphates may also be formed from co-phosphates by mutases (Fig. 27) with 1,co-diphosphates as intermediates. [Pg.112]
